What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Baker,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Baker, you need expertise in baking techniques, ingredient measurements, and food safety, typically supported by a culinary or baking certification. Familiarity with commercial ovens, mixers, and inventory management systems is commonly required. Attention to detail, creativity, time management, and teamwork are standout soft skills in this role. These skills ensure consistently high-quality baked goods, efficient kitchen operations, and customer satisfaction in a competitive food industry.

What are some common challenges bakery staff face during busy periods, and how can they effectively manage them?

Bakery staff often experience high-pressure situations during peak hours, such as early mornings or weekends, when customer demand is highest. Common challenges include maintaining product quality while working quickly, managing inventory to prevent shortages, and providing excellent customer service. Effective time management, clear communication among team members, and staying organized are key strategies to handle these periods smoothly. Many bakeries also implement prep schedules and designate roles to ensure efficiency and minimize stress.

What is a bakery?

A bakery is a place where a variety of baked goods such as bread, pastries, cakes, and cookies are prepared and sold. Bakeries can range from small local shops to large commercial operations. Many bakeries also offer custom cakes and specialty items for events. Bakers use different ingredients and techniques to produce fresh, flavorful products daily. Visiting a bakery is a great way to enjoy fresh, handmade treats.

What we need from you:

  • Outstanding customer service skills 
  • Desire to gain an understanding of food production and basic cooking techniques  
  • Effective communication skills and willingness to work as part of a team 
  • Strong work ethic and ability to work in a fast-paced environment with a sense of urgency 
  • Good basic math skills 
  • Ability to obtain current food handlers permit once employed

As a Bakery Clerk you will:

  • Bakery Clerk will prepare items per customer requests using proper bakery equipment.
  • Bakery Team Member should offer product samples to help customers discover new items or products they inquire about.
  • Bakery Clerk will be able to inform customers of bakery specials.
  • Provide customers with fresh products that they have ordered and the correct portion size (or as close as possible to the amount ordered) to prevent shrink.
  • Recommend bakery items to customers to ensure they get the products they want and need.
  • Use all equipment in bakery such as the refrigerators, freezers, and ovens according to company guidelines.
  • Prepare foods according to the food temperature logs and follow cooking/baking instructions.
  • Measure, prepare and mix ingredients according to recipe, using variety of kitchen utensils and equipment.
  • Adequately prepare, package, label and inventory ingredients in merchandise.
  • Check product quality to ensure freshness. Review "sell by" dates and take appropriate action.
  • Properly use kitchen equipment, stove, computerized scale, fryer, steamer, robot coupe etc.
  • Label, stock and inventory department merchandise.
  • Report product ordering/shipping discrepancies to the department manager.
  • Understand the store's layout and be able to locate products when requested by customer.
  • Stay current with present, future, seasonal and special ads.
  • Gain and maintain knowledge of products sold within the department and be able to respond to questions and make suggestions about products.
  • Maintain an awareness of inventory/stocking conditions note any discrepancies in inventory.
  • Ensure proper temperatures in cases and coolers are maintained and temperature logs are maintained.
  • Promote trust and respect among associates.
  • Create an environment that enables customers to feel welcome, important and appreciated by answering questions regarding products sold within the department and throughout the store.
  • Adhere to all food safety regulations and guidelines.
  • Reinforce safety programs by complying with safety procedures and identify unsafe conditions and notify store management.
  • Display a positive attitude.
  • Practice preventive maintenance by properly inspecting equipment and notify appropriate department or store manager of any items in need of repair.
  • Notify management of customer or employee accidents.
  • Report all safety risk, or issues, and illegal activity, including robbery, theft or fraud.
  • Must be able to perform the essential functions of this position with or without reasonable accommodation.
